EPA gives update on Sporlan site

A representative from the Environmental Protection Agency (EPA) says cleanup operations at a former Sporlan Valve manufacturing plant could take another 30 years to fully complete.

Washington fire station design contract approved

The Washington City Council approved a $583,690 contract Monday with FGM Architects for design of a new fire station south of Phoenix Park.

Washington City Council rejects deer dressing ordinance

The Washington City Council voted down a proposal last week that would have created an ordinance prohibiting field dressing or processing deer in public.
